-// TestNetAddressWire tests the NetAddress wire encode and decode for various
-// protocol versions and timestamp flag combinations.
-func TestNetAddressWire(t *testing.T) {
- // baseNetAddr is used in the various tests as a baseline NetAddress.
- baseNetAddr := NetAddress{
- Timestamp: time.Unix(0x495fab29, 0), // 2009-01-03 12:15:05 -0600 CST
- Services: SFNodeNetwork,
- IP: net.ParseIP("127.0.0.1"),
- Port: 8333,
- }
-
- // baseNetAddrNoTS is baseNetAddr with a zero value for the timestamp.
- baseNetAddrNoTS := baseNetAddr
- baseNetAddrNoTS.Timestamp = time.Time{}
-
- // baseNetAddrEncoded is the wire encoded bytes of baseNetAddr.
- baseNetAddrEncoded := []byte{
- 0x29, 0xab, 0x5f, 0x49, // Timestamp
- 0x01, 0x00, 0x00, 0x00, 0x00, 0x00, 0x00, 0x00, // SFNodeNetwork
- 0x00, 0x00, 0x00, 0x00, 0x00, 0x00, 0x00, 0x00,
- 0x00, 0x00, 0xff, 0xff, 0x7f, 0x00, 0x00, 0x01, // IP 127.0.0.1
- 0x20, 0x8d, // Port 8333 in big-endian
- }
-
- // baseNetAddrNoTSEncoded is the wire encoded bytes of baseNetAddrNoTS.
- baseNetAddrNoTSEncoded := []byte{
- // No timestamp
- 0x01, 0x00, 0x00, 0x00, 0x00, 0x00, 0x00, 0x00, // SFNodeNetwork
- 0x00, 0x00, 0x00, 0x00, 0x00, 0x00, 0x00, 0x00,
- 0x00, 0x00, 0xff, 0xff, 0x7f, 0x00, 0x00, 0x01, // IP 127.0.0.1
- 0x20, 0x8d, // Port 8333 in big-endian
- }
